How do I DIY a large wall clock?
My Dad is 91 and has terrible vision. He has always loved Mickey Mouse especially since I worked at WDW when I was a teenager 30+ years ago. The only watch he will ever wear has to have Mickey's face on it... lol. My idea for his upcoming 92 birthday was to make a large Mickey Mouse wall clock he can see from across the room when he sits in 'his' chair -- perhaps 16" diameter if round or 20 x 20" if square. ??? I do want mine to be a very nice authentic (looking) clock (hopefully with Mickey's hands being the clock hands... but that's not a necessity). The hands just need to be very identifiable.
Any ideas on finding a decal or pic that size; material to use (I was thinking wood); stain, paint,???
[Most commercial ones are only about 8-10 inches diameter and the clock hands are very difficult to differentiate from the clock pattern.]
Would appreciate any ideas,Thanks!

I make a lot of custom clocks out of all kinds of things. I would make a clock round or purchase one, get a clock mechanism from Michael's or Hobby Lobby or https://www.klockit.com/ . Find a picture of Mickey Mouse in stores or online. Decoupage the photo on the clock round. Install the clock mechanism.

You could buy Clock hands and movements, you could also add to the clock hands with 2 x pieces of sticky back plastic (back to back) to make bigger hands etc. Hope that helps. You might even look on ebay to see what's on offer already.
You can take an image off the internet, have it scaled up and printed larger then cut out the parts and adhere them to wood or whatever you'd like, maybe foam core could even work. Then assemble a clock out of it using clock parts which you can find online.
